The document discusses several key hardware technologies for game platforms:
- Human-Computer Interface (HCI) focuses on how easy the computer is to navigate and use. A good interface is important for usability and enjoyment, though advanced capabilities require more complexity.
- The Central Processing Unit (CPU) acts as the computer's brain, controlling and processing all actions and information. It is crucial to basic system function.
- The Graphics Processing Unit (GPU) handles graphics processing to reduce strain on the CPU. This improves performance for graphics-intensive tasks like gaming.

This document provides an overview of wound healing, its functions, stages, mechanisms, factors affecting it, and complications.
A wound is a break in the integrity of the skin or tissues, which may be associated with disruption of the structure and function.
Healing is the body’s response to injury in an attempt to restore normal structure and functions.
Healing can occur in two ways: Regeneration and Repair
There are 4 phases of wound healing: hemostasis, inflammation, proliferation, and remodeling. This document also describes the mechanism of wound healing. Factors that affect healing include infection, uncontrolled diabetes, poor nutrition, age, anemia, the presence of foreign bodies, etc.
Complications of wound healing like infection, hyperpigmentation of scar, contractures, and keloid formation.
